Fragrance Story

L'Eau d'Issey City Blossom by Issey Miyake is a Floral Woody Musk fragrance for women. L'Eau d'Issey City Blossom was launched in 2015. The nose behind this fragrance is Alberto Morillas. Top notes are Calone, Pink Pepper, Bergamot and Lemon; middle notes are Magnolia, Freesia, Lily-of-the-Valley, Rose and Osmanthus; base notes are White Cedar Extract, White Musk, Ambroxan and Honey.
